Job Title: Senior Oracle SQL Analyst Work Location: Atlanta, GA Work Mode: Hybrid Duration: 10+ Months Interview process: Onsite Job Summary Under limited supervision, the Senior Oracle SQL Data Analyst develops, maintains, and supports Oracle SQL and PL/SQL solutions for operational reporting, research, executive decision-making, legislative reporting, and strategic initiatives. The role focuses on writing SQL from scratch against normalized Oracle transactional databases, analyzing business requirements, identifying tables and relationships, extracting and validating operational data, automating SQL processes, troubleshooting data issues, and supporting reporting and Tableau initiatives. Key Responsibilities • Develop, maintain, and optimize complex Oracle SQL and PL/SQL programs. • Write simple and complex SQL queries from scratch against normalized Oracle transactional databases. • Analyze business requirements and determine the appropriate tables, relationships, joins, and business rules needed to answer complex business questions. • Extract, validate, transform, and analyze operational data for reporting, research, grants, and executive requests. • Develop and maintain automated SQL processes, scheduled database jobs, and recurring data refreshes. • Troubleshoot SQL scripts, automated jobs, and data quality issues. • Create efficient, reusable, and well-documented SQL code. • Support recurring operational reports,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), legislative reporting, and research initiatives. • Collaborate with business users to understand reporting needs and communicate analytical findings. • Support Tableau dashboards and other data visualization initiatives as needed.
